Advances in Crystallography of Coordination Complexes on Main Group Metals with Amino Acid Ligands

Abstract: The study of main-group metal elements and their coordination complexes with amino acids is an important theme in coordination chemistry, but it has often been overshadowed by the intense interest in transition-metal coordination complexes. In recent years, there has been a growing interest in main-group compounds, extending across all members of sand p-blocks in the Period Table, which has resulted in the discovery of numerous new classes of compounds with previously unknown structures and bonding.
